如何在navicat创建数据库和数据表

如何在navicat创建数据库和数据表

在Navicat中创建数据库和数据表非常简单、直观、高效。首先,打开Navicat并连接到数据库服务器。然后,右键点击连接名,选择“新建数据库”,按照提示输入数据库名称并选择字符集。接下来,选择新建的数据库,右键点击选择“新建表”,在弹出的窗口中定义表结构并保存。下面将详细介绍每一步骤。

一、安装和配置Navicat

1、下载和安装Navicat

首先,确保你已经下载并安装了Navicat的最新版本。Navicat有多个版本,包括Navicat for MySQL、Navicat for PostgreSQL等,根据你的数据库类型选择合适的版本。

2、启动Navicat并创建连接

打开Navicat后,点击左上角的“连接”按钮。根据你使用的数据库类型,选择相应的连接类型(如MySQL、PostgreSQL等)。在弹出的窗口中输入连接名称、主机名、端口号、用户名和密码等信息,点击“连接测试”以确保连接成功,然后点击“确定”。

二、创建数据库

1、打开连接并新建数据库

连接成功后,展开左侧的连接节点,右键点击连接名,选择“新建数据库”。在弹出的窗口中输入数据库名称,并选择适当的字符集。字符集一般选择utf8mb4,这样可以支持更多语言和表情符号。

2、设置数据库属性

除了名称和字符集外,还可以设置其他属性,如排序规则等。通常默认设置已经足够,但在特定需求下可以根据需要进行调整。设置完成后,点击“确定”按钮,新数据库就会出现在连接下的数据库列表中。

三、创建数据表

1、选择数据库并新建表

在左侧树状列表中展开新建的数据库,右键点击“表”节点,选择“新建表”。这将打开一个新窗口,你可以在其中定义数据表的结构。

2、定义表结构

在新建表的窗口中,输入表名,并在列定义区域添加列。每列需要定义名称、数据类型、长度、是否为空、主键等属性。常见的数据类型包括INT、VARCHAR、DATE等。例如,创建一个用户表,包含用户ID、用户名、密码和注册日期等字段。

3、设置主键和索引

在定义表结构时,通常需要设置主键和索引。主键用于唯一标识表中的每一行数据,索引用于加速查询。在列定义区域中,右键点击需要设置为主键的列,选择“设置为主键”。同样,可以根据需要添加索引。

4、保存表结构

定义完表结构后,点击工具栏上的“保存”按钮,输入表名并确认保存。此时,新建的数据表已经在数据库中创建完成。

四、插入和查询数据

1、插入数据

创建好数据表后,可以开始插入数据。右键点击表名,选择“打开表”,在弹出的数据表视图中手动输入数据,或使用SQL语句插入数据。SQL语句示例:

INSERT INTO users (username, password, registration_date) VALUES ('john_doe', 'password123', '2023-10-01');

2、查询数据

同样,可以使用SQL语句查询数据。例如,查询所有用户:

SELECT * FROM users;

也可以右键点击表名,选择“查询”来打开查询窗口,输入查询语句并执行。

五、管理和维护数据库

1、备份和恢复

定期备份数据库是非常重要的。在Navicat中,可以右键点击数据库名,选择“转储SQL文件”,按照提示选择备份路径和文件名,点击“开始”进行备份。恢复数据库时,右键点击连接名,选择“运行SQL文件”,选择备份文件并执行。

2、优化和维护

为了保持数据库的高效运行,需要定期进行优化和维护。Navicat提供了数据库优化工具,可以通过右键点击数据库名,选择“优化表”来优化表结构。此外,还可以通过定期检查和修复表来确保数据完整性。

六、使用项目管理系统

在管理数据库项目时,使用高效的项目管理工具可以大大提高工作效率。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ile。这两款工具都提供了强大的项目管理功能,可以帮助团队更好地协作和管理项目。

1、PingCode

PingCode是一款专为研发团队设计的项目管理系统,支持需求管理、缺陷管理、测试管理等功能。其独特的研发流程管理功能,可以帮助团队更好地进行需求分析和任务分配,提高开发效率。

2、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的团队。其任务管理、时间管理、文件共享等功能,可以帮助团队成员更好地协作和沟通。Worktile还支持与多种第三方工具集成,如GitHub、JIRA等,方便团队进行综合管理。

通过上述步骤,你可以轻松在Navicat中创建数据库和数据表,并通过高效的项目管理工具更好地管理你的数据库项目。希望这些内容能对你有所帮助!

相关问答FAQs:

1. 如何在Navicat中创建一个新的数据库?

  • 在Navicat的菜单栏中,选择“文件”>“新建连接”。
  • 在弹出的对话框中,选择数据库类型和连接方式,填写相关信息(如主机名、端口号、用户名和密码)并点击“连接”按钮。
  • 成功连接数据库后,在导航栏中右键点击“连接名”,选择“新建数据库”。
  • 输入数据库名称并点击“确定”按钮,即可成功创建一个新的数据库。

2. 如何在Navicat中创建一个新的数据表?

  • 连接到已经存在的数据库后,在导航栏中找到对应的数据库,右键点击该数据库并选择“打开”。
  • 在左侧导航栏中,选择“表格”选项卡,然后点击工具栏上的“新建表格”按钮。
  • 在弹出的对话框中,填写表格的名称、字段名称、数据类型、长度等相关信息,并点击“确定”按钮。
  • 完成上述步骤后,即可成功创建一个新的数据表。

3. 如何在Navicat中导入数据到已存在的数据表?

  • 连接到已经存在的数据库后,在导航栏中找到对应的数据库,右键点击该数据库并选择“打开”。
  • 在左侧导航栏中,选择“表格”选项卡,找到目标数据表并右键点击该数据表。
  • 在弹出的菜单中,选择“导入向导”选项。
  • 在导入向导中,选择数据源文件和目标表格,然后点击“下一步”按钮。
  • 根据需要选择导入的数据格式和数据选项,然后点击“下一步”按钮。
  • 最后,点击“完成”按钮,即可成功将数据导入到已存在的数据表中。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2089899

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部